##Ingredients

To make these flourless cottage cheese pancakes, you will need the following ingredients:

– 1 cup cottage cheese

– 4 eggs

– 1 tablespoon honey or maple syrup

– 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

– 1/2 cup rolled oats

– 1/2 teaspoon baking powder

– Pinch of salt

– Butter or oil for cooking

– Optional toppings: fresh berries, sliced bananas, honey, or maple syrup

##Steps

Now that you have gathered all the necessary ingredients, it’s time to get cooking! Follow these simple steps to make your own batch of delicious flourless cottage cheese pancakes:

1. In a blender or food processor, combine the cottage cheese, eggs, honey or maple syrup, and vanilla extract. Blend until smooth and well combined.

2. Add the rolled oats, baking powder, and a pinch of salt to the blender. Blend again until the mixture is smooth and the oats are fully incorporated.

3. Heat a non-stick skillet or griddle over medium heat. Add a small amount of butter or oil to the pan and spread it around to coat the surface.

4. Pour approximately 1/4 cup of the pancake batter onto the hot skillet for each pancake. Cook until bubbles form on the surface, then flip and cook for an additional 1-2 minutes, or until golden brown.

5. Transfer the cooked pancakes to a plate and keep them warm in a low-temperature oven while you cook the remaining batter.

6. Serve your flourless cottage cheese pancakes with your favorite toppings, such as fresh berries, sliced bananas, and a drizzle of honey or maple syrup. Enjoy!

##Variations

Once you have mastered the basic recipe for flourless cottage cheese pancakes, feel free to get creative and experiment with different flavors and additions. Here are a few variations to try:

1. Blueberry Bliss: Add a handful of fresh or frozen blueberries to the pancake batter before cooking. The burst of sweet blueberries will add a delightful burst of flavor to every bite.

2. Chocolate Delight: For all the chocolate lovers out there, add a tablespoon of cocoa powder to the pancake batter. This will give your pancakes a rich and indulgent chocolate flavor.

3. Nutty Goodness: Sprinkle some chopped nuts, such as almonds or walnuts, onto the pancakes just before flipping them. The added crunch and nutty flavor will take your pancakes to the next level.

4. Cinnamon Spice: Mix a teaspoon of ground cinnamon into the batter for a warm and comforting taste. Serve with a dusting of powdered sugar for an extra touch of sweetness.

##Tips

To ensure your flourless cottage cheese pancakes turn out perfectly every time, here are a few helpful tips:

1. Use a blender or food processor to ensure a smooth and well-incorporated batter. This will help the pancakes hold together and have a consistent texture.

2. Make sure to cook the pancakes on medium heat. Cooking them too quickly on high heat may result in burnt edges and an undercooked center.

3. It’s important to let the pancakes cook until bubbles form on the surface before flipping them. This ensures that they are cooked through and will be fluffy and light.

4. If you prefer a sweeter pancake, you can increase the amount of honey or maple syrup in the batter. Alternatively, you can serve the pancakes with a generous drizzle of honey or maple syrup.

##FAQs

1. Can I use a different type of cheese instead of cottage cheese?

While cottage cheese works best for this recipe, you can experiment with other soft cheeses such as ricotta or quark. Just keep in mind that the texture and flavor may vary slightly.

2. Can I make the batter ahead of time?

Yes, you can prepare the batter ahead of time and store it in the refrigerator for up to 24 hours. Just give it a quick stir before cooking the pancakes.

3. Can I freeze the cooked pancakes?

Absolutely! Once the pancakes have cooled, you can stack them with a piece of parchment paper between each pancake and freeze them in an airtight container. When you’re ready to enjoy them, simply reheat them in a toaster or oven.

4. Are these pancakes suitable for a vegetarian or gluten-free diet?

Yes, these flourless cottage cheese pancakes are suitable for both vegetarian and gluten-free diets. Just make sure to use certified gluten-free oats if you have a gluten intolerance or allergy.

5. How many pancakes does this recipe make?

This recipe yields approximately 8 medium-sized pancakes. If you need more, you can easily double or triple the recipe to serve a larger crowd.
